Livistona chinensis

CHINESE FOUNTAIN PALM

Palms and cycads, Trees

LIVISTONA

These slow-growing fan palms somewhat resemble Washingtonia but generally have shorter, darker, shinier leaves. They are hardy to about 22°F/–6°C. All make good potted plants.

Livistona chinensis

From Japan, Taiwan. Very slow growing; eventually to 40 ft. tall, 15 ft. wide. Roundish, bright green, 3–6-ft.- wide leaves droop strongly at outer edges.
